Additional Information
  • Description: Male vocal solo, with orchestra
  • Instrumentation: 3 violins, viola, flute, 2 clarinets, bassoon, 2 cornets, trombone, and tuba
  • Category: Vocal
  • Language: Polish
  • Master Size: 10-in.
Notes
Victor ledgers state, "12 men." For this day it is believed to indicate the instrumentation shown. The instrumentation is not confirmed.
